The buckle shown, does not belong (and never has been!) on a Stable-belt. It is much too heavy. It is often also seen with the King`s Crown, as the GS buckle is that ancient! There are two different areas here, that have been wrongly combined.
The belt is a normal belt of the Royal Artillery, minus it`s leather accessories or link buckle (Army cadets are renowned for constructing such mixtures when parts are scarce).
The wearing of Stable-Belts (a non issued Item) with Dress uniforms is and was, strictly against Army Dress Regulations. That means, there are two forms of Dress here also. A unit RSM would have a fit. It is also badly in need of a clean.
